Chinese rapist who gave online number to victim busted
New Delhi, July 2 (ANI): Two Chinese rapists were taken into custody after one of them left his number on QQ, most popular free instant messaging computer program in Mainland China, for the woman after attacking her.
The woman was at a square with her boyfriend when the two men rode up on a motorcycle.
The pair forced the beau to go away before sexually assaulting the victim, reports the China Daily.
The woman later recalled that one of her attackers had given her a QQ number, and asked her to make contact.
Cops called the online number, and trapped the rapist pretending to be the girl.
The rapist bought the story and appeared for the date, only to be arrested later. (ANI)
